Default ITR motor build Update *56k suicide*:

My ITR motor started getting rebuilt this weekend. I got my block back from the machine shop. They bored it to 81.5mm and also micropolished the crank. The pistons I'm using are JE 11.5:1 and Eagle Rods.

Im not on that band Wagon Either, I was asking because it seems you went overboard On the parts you choose! For the compression your running It would make no differnce to have Run OEM, Being they can hold up with no problems! I am also assuming with That compression you will be around or under 200whp (depending on other parts), In which Eagle rods are way over kill!

I am just Trying to help, Seems like alot of People on this Site seem to think You must have Forged Pistons or Aftermarket rods, Because they dont understand that the OEM parts are not only Very Light, but Strong and Cheaper!
